A.1.1 The mingling of the races (cca.250,000 B.C. – 11th century) History of British newspapers Wikipedia The history of British newspapers dates to the 17th century with the emergence of regular publications covering news and gossip. The relaxation of government censorship in the late 17th century led to a rise in publications, which in turn led to an increase in regulation throughout the 18th century. The Times began publication in 1785 and became the leading newspaper of the early 19th century ... Home British Pharmacopoeia Online and as an updated download.
